The Jodi’s Journey Scholarship Fund was created in memory of one of our board members who died on October 14th of this year from a hard fought and courageous battle with cancer . She was also the mom of a current senior cheerleader and current sophomore football player. Jodi was the light of her community in Carver, MA. She was a well-known and well-loved dance teacher, a special education educator in the Plymouth North school district, and very philanthropic herself. Every year she organized a holiday toy drive and she was constantly looking for ways to help families and young children. She will be greatly missed.
The program that we are supporting at tonight’s game is a scholarship; “The Jodi’s Journey Scholarship Fund” was created by her family in her memory. The proceeds of the scholarship, each year, will go to 1 graduating senior at Old Colony Regional Vocational Technical High School and 1 graduating senior at Carver High School. We are kicking off the fundraising at tonight’s football game and will continue to promote it on-going as an organization.
